New automation action that executes user scripts from a dedicated scripts/ directory. Available as both a DO action and THEN action. Scripts are selected from a dropdown populated by /api/scripts. Security: only scripts in the scripts dir can run, path traversal blocked, no shell=True, stdout/stderr capped, configurable timeout (max 300s). Scripts receive SOULSYNC_EVENT, SOULSYNC_AUTOMATION, and SOULSYNC_SCRIPTS_DIR environment variables. Includes Dockerfile + docker-compose.yml changes for the scripts volume mount, and three example scripts (hello_world.sh, system_info.py, notify_ntfy.sh).
